- [ ] Step 7: Archive cold storage buckets (Glacierline tier). Confirm both ceremony witnesses are present, verify bucket manifests match the Oxbow ledger, then seal the archive key shares. Plugin authors may observe but not handle shares. Once sealed, the archive index itself is encrypted and can only be reopened with the passphrase below.

vault phrase of badup-hahig = tamael-aldael-kelmir-istael-fenok-istwyn-tamius-jorath-oliion

## Formula sandbox tuning

User-supplied formulas in Gridmoor execute inside a restricted interpreter with hard ceilings on time, memory, and call depth. Reviewers should confirm any change to these ceilings is justified in the PR description, since raising them widens the abuse surface. Defaults were chosen from production traces. The current limits are as follows.

limits module of tafog-fawip:
WEIGHTS = {
    "julix": 57,
    "lamys": 992,
    "kasvan": 209,
    "quenok": 750,
    "alddor": 259,
    "oliath": 1009,
    "wenix": 815,
}

Reviewer: before approving the ceremony PR for TilePorter, our map-tile prefetcher, confirm the following. The old prefetch-manifest signing key must be revoked in the Quillbrook registry, the new key fingerprint recorded in the ceremony log, and two witnesses noted in the PR description. Verify the escrow archive was re-encrypted and that the test prefetch against the staging tile grid validates signatures cleanly. Once all boxes are ticked, record the escrow recovery passphrase, shown below.

unlock words, hahip-baduf: holwyn-istath-julvan

Subject: Q3 stock-count ledger – transport

Dispatch,

The Q3 stock-count ledger is boxed and ready at the front office for tomorrow's run to the Branwick head office. It must travel sealed; no copies, no stops. Book Merrow Courier, morning slot only. Confirm once scheduled.

Apply the following at hand-over:

— T. Aldwyn, Office Manager

handover note for yagef-bagep: the drudor pelius courier leaves the kasdor zorvan norir ledger at gate 8016 under passcode 755406